Senior Scientist | Mathematical & Physics Signals Modeling | Experimental Interface | Deep Tech | Healthtech Startup



Job description

Job Description

We are looking for a Senior Scientist with expertise in theoretical and computational modeling to join our research team.

In this role, you will develop mathematical frameworks, computational simulations, and analytical methods to describe complex physical systems, working closely with experimentalists and interdisciplinary scientists to validate and refine your models.

Your insights will directly influence experimental design, data interpretation, and technology development, ensuring a tight loop between theory and practice.

If you are a scientist who enjoys bridging the gap between theory and experiment, with a passion for developing models that have real-world impact, this is the perfect opportunity to push the boundaries of physical science while working in a collaborative and fast-paced environment.

About Your Role | What Will You Be Doing?

  • Develop and refine mathematical models for complex physical systems targeting personalized medicine, ensuring their applicability to real-world experiments.

  • Work closely with experimental teams, translating theoretical predictions into testable hypotheses and guiding data collection/analysis.

  • Apply analytical and computational techniques, including simulations and numerical modeling, to study physical phenomena.

  • Utilize statistical physics, quantum mechanics, and applied mathematics to extract meaningful insights from experimental data.

  • Assist in analysing and interpreting experimental data, ensuring that theoretical expectations align with practical feasibility.

  • Stay up to date with the latest advancements in physics, computational modeling, and advances in spectroscopy for clinical applications. 

  • Communicate findings effectively across disciplines, ensuring alignment between theoretical and experimental efforts.

  • Contribute to research publications, patents, and presentations at leading conferences.

Requirements ✔️

  • Strong expertise in theoretical and computational physics or applied mathematics, with a demonstrated ability to apply these concepts to real-world experiments in an interdisciplinary setting.

  • Proven experience working at the interface of theory and experiment, collaborating with experimentalists, interdisciplinary scientists and engineers.

  • Proficiency in numerical modeling, simulations, and data analysis using Python, Julia, or similar tools.

  • Ability to develop and implement physical models, differential equations, and computational frameworks to solve complex problems.

  • Experience with data-driven approaches, signal processing, or machine learning for scientific applications is a plus.

  • A deep curiosity for solving interdisciplinary challenges, with an innovative and problem-solving mindset.

  • Excellent communication skills, capable of translating complex theoretical concepts into practical applications and to non-specialists in a clear engaging way. 

  • Proven track record of scientific publications in peer-reviewed journals or major scientific conferences.

 


Qualifications

 

  • PhD or Msc in Physics, Applied Mathematics, Theoretical Physics, Physical Chemistry, Mathematics, or a related field.

    Exceptional candidates with a Master’s degree and extensive research experience will also be considered.

  • +3 years of experience in academia or industry, working on modelling and simulations with experimental applications.

  • Experience in developing theories/models that have been tested in experimental setups.

  • Previous collaboration with experimental physicists, engineers, or applied scientists.

  • Experience supervising junior researchers is welcome but not required.
